Sovereign & Bale is seeking an experienced IPS Team Leader to oversee a team delivering the Connect to Work programme across West London. The role involves leading a dedicated team, ensuring quality delivery and supporting staff development in a community-focused environment.
The ideal candidate will have a passion for employment support, strong management experience, and the ability to foster partnerships with local health services and employers. This full-time role requires regular travel within the community hubs.
